[0001] This utility model relates to the technical field of bucket tippers, specifically a bucket tipper that assists in tipping over goods. Background Technology

[0002] Buckets are key components installed on excavators and other machinery for digging, loading, and other operations. They are usually made of materials such as manganese steel and can be divided into backhoe buckets and front shovel buckets according to their working method. Backhoe buckets are more commonly used. The structure of a bucket is complex, consisting of multiple parts such as toothed plate, bottom plate, and side plate. Buckets are not only used for digging operations, but also for loading, crushing stones, and transporting goods.

[0003] When transporting goods with a bucket, it is necessary to first drive the loader equipped with the bucket to the vicinity of the goods, insert the bucket under the goods, lift the goods by raising the bucket, and move the goods to the target location. However, the goods in the existing buckets are unloaded manually, which requires workers to use tools to shovel the goods out of the bucket. This is time-consuming and labor-intensive, and also reduces the efficiency of goods transportation. Utility Model Content

[0022] Please see Figure 1 and Figure 2 This utility model provides a technical solution: a bucket tipper for assisting in tipping over goods, including a mounting frame 1, a mounting plate 101 and a mounting base 102, wherein the mounting plate 101 is welded to one side of the mounting frame 1 and the mounting base 102 is welded to the bottom of the mounting frame 1;

[0023] A T-shaped beam 2 is symmetrically connected to one side of the mounting base 102. A sliding frame 3 is provided on the upper side of the T-shaped beam 2. Each sliding frame 3 has a T-shaped groove 301 inside. The inner side of each sliding frame 3 is inserted into the T-shaped beam 2 through the T-shaped groove 301. A connecting plate 302 is welded to the top of the two sliding frames 3. A connecting block 3021 is welded to one side of the connecting plate 302. A lifting seat 4 is welded to the lower side of the two sliding frames 3. Hooks 5 are symmetrically provided on the inner side of the lifting seat 4. The outer side of the lifting seat 4 is connected to one end of the hydraulic cylinder 6. The other end of the hydraulic cylinder 6 is connected to the mounting base 102.

[0024] In specific implementation, to improve the efficiency of bucket transporting goods, the bucket tilter is first installed and connected to the forklift via mounting plate 101, mounting base 102, and connecting block 3021, and the oil circuit is connected. The hook 5 is hooked to one side of the bucket, and the hydraulic cylinder 6 installed with mounting base 102 is activated. At this time, the hydraulic cylinder 6 is slidably connected to the T-beam 2 via the sliding frame 3 through the inner T-slot 301, which drives the sliding frame 3 and the hook 5 on the inner side of the sliding frame 3 to move upward, thereby driving one end of the bucket to move upward, and then dumping the goods in the bucket. The tops of the two sliding frames 3 form a sliding frame after being connected by the connecting plate 302, which facilitates the stable installation of the lifting base 4. This bucket tilter that assists in tilting goods can achieve fast and labor-saving unloading by driving the bucket to tilt the goods through the hydraulic cylinder 6, thereby improving the efficiency of goods transportation.

[0025] See Figure 3 and Figure 4 It is known that an adjusting block 7 is welded to the top of each of the two hooks 5. The adjusting block 7 has a through groove 701 and a threaded hole 704 inside. The adjusting block 7 is inserted into the adjusting rod 702 through the through groove 701. Both ends of the adjusting rod 702 are welded to the lifting seat 4. The adjusting rod 702 has a threaded groove 703 inside. An adjusting bolt 705 is provided in the middle of the adjusting block 7. The outer side of the adjusting bolt 705 is threadedly connected to the threaded groove 703 and the threaded hole 704 on the adjacent side.

[0026] In practical implementation, to make the bucket tilter adaptable to different buckets, according to the size of the bucket, remove the adjusting bolt 705 on the top of the hook 5. At this time, the adjusting block 7 connected to the hook 5 can be pushed and moved along the adjusting rod 702 through the through groove 701 inside the adjusting block 7. After moving the hook 5 connected to the adjusting block 7 to the appropriate position, align the adjusting bolt 705 with the threaded hole 704 inside the adjusting block 7 and abut against the top of the threaded hole 704 and rotate it until the adjusting bolt 705 is threadedly connected to the threaded hole 704 and the threaded groove 703 on the adjacent side. This bucket tilter that assists in tilting goods can adjust the position of the hook 5 inside the lifting seat 4, thereby adapting to different buckets and making it more convenient to use.
